Output 18e18cca6b8c33e3392f501bbed6237d001b7b6d96f752ec1d516d187b0a4352:6

value
654560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2615fdc2c2660cb99549c0a540ee591bc8ada53e OP_EQUAL
address
35APwp52XdLx5gynLyyc8oikNAM9p6pu2h
transaction
18e18cca6b8c33e3392f501bbed6237d001b7b6d96f752ec1d516d187b0a4352
spent
true